Navigation Pane

The Navigation Pane contains three special items:

Besides, the Specific settings item has a list of subitems where each subitem represents a particular specific window rule. You can collapse or expand the Specific settings list by clicking the plus/minus sign on the left of its name. Every item in this list also has a check box on the left of its name. You can mark/unmark this check box to enable/disable a particular rule.

Navigation Pane

Upon selecting an item, the Details Pane will show this item's options so you can modify them as you like. You can select an item by:

  • left- or right-clicking its name
  • using the cursor keys
  • typing a few first letters of its name to jump to it quickly

Also, you can use the Navigation Pane to relocate a particular Specific settings item by dragging it with a mouse:

  • left-click the desired item and hold the left mouse button
  • without releasing the button, move the mouse to the desired new position
  • release the left mouse button

Multi-selection Edit Mode

This feature should be of great use in case you want to assign the same value to a certain property in several Specific Settings items: just select them, then open the desired property sheet and adjust the required property - and it will be automatically changed in all selected items.

To select several items, press and hold the <Ctrl> key, then click the left mouse button on a desired Specific settings item in the Navigation Pane; without releasing the <Ctrl> key click on another item, and so on. To cancel the multi-selection edit mode, click on any item in the Navigation Pane with the <Ctrl> key released.

You should consider the following notes when using the multi-selection edit mode:

  • you can deselect any item (thus, excluding it from a multi-selection) in a same way you select it - press and hold the <Ctrl> key and click the left mouse button on it (please note that the item that was selected when you started the multi-selection cannot be deselected in such way)
  • when all selected items have the same value in a certain property it appears as is but if at least one of selected items has a different value for this property - it will appear undefined: empty in edit boxes and combo boxes, undefined in check boxes (grayed), unselected in radio buttons (all buttons have no mark on them), zero in track bars
  • if you modify any property in the multi-selection edit mode - the same change will be made to all selected Specific Settings items
